Range Rover: Before starting or driving - After a collision - Range Rover Owner's ManualRange Rover: Before starting or driving

If the vehicle is involved in a collision it should be checked by a Land Rover Retailer/Authorized Repairer, or suitably qualified persons, before starting or driving.
